Consultation Terms
How a booking is confirmed, how sessions run, what you receive, and what is expected on both sides.
These Consultation Terms explain how a session works in practice once you book one. They sit alongside the Terms of Service and apply to every marketing consultation delivered by Omnivictus.
01How a booking is confirmed
You request a session by opening a service and sending a booking request, or by sending a message. We reply to confirm availability and, where a fee applies, to arrange payment.
Your session is confirmed only once we reply to agree a time. Until then, no time is reserved.
02Preparing for your session
The more you share in advance, the more useful the session. Before we meet, it helps to have a clear sense of your goals and your current situation.
- A short note on your business and who you are trying to reach.
- The marketing you are doing now and what is or is not working.
- Any specific questions or decisions you want to focus on.
- Access to any figures you are comfortable discussing, at a high level.
03How the session runs
Consultations are held online, by video or voice, whichever you prefer. At the agreed time we join a call, work through your questions and goals, and talk them through in plain language.
Sessions are focused and practical. We keep to the time booked; if a topic needs more depth than one session allows, we will say so and suggest how to continue.
04What you receive
After the session we write up what we discussed and send it to you, usually within two business days. The summary captures the recommendations and the next steps, so you can act on them at your own pace.
The written summary is the deliverable. Anything said live is guidance; the summary is what you keep and refer back to.
05Rescheduling and cancellations
Life happens, and sessions can be moved with reasonable notice.
- Reschedule or cancel with at least twenty-four hours' notice at no charge.
- With less notice, a session may be treated as delivered where a fee applies.
- If we ever need to move a session, we will offer you the earliest suitable alternative.
06Your responsibilities
For the session to work, a few things rest with you.
- Join at the agreed time from a place where you can talk freely.
- Share accurate information so the advice fits your situation.
- Make your own decisions about acting on the recommendations.
- Tell us in advance if someone else will join the call.
07Acting on the advice
We advise; you decide. Any changes you make, tools you buy or budgets you spend as a result of a consultation are your own decisions, and results depend on how the advice is put into practice and on factors outside our control.
Our recommendations are informed guidance based on the information you share. They are not a guarantee of any particular result, and outcomes will vary with your market and execution.
08Confidentiality
We treat what you share about your business as confidential and use it only to deliver your consultation. We do not share it outside what the session requires, and we can keep a project private on request.
09Changes to these terms
We may update these consultation terms as our practice develops. The date at the top of the page records when the current version took effect, and the version in force when your booking is confirmed governs that booking.
